RBS customers worried over global financial crisis
Royal Bank of Scotland customers in Edinburgh today spoke of their concerns over the dramatic drop in its share price.
Workers at the bank’s historic base on St Andrew’s Square were tight-lipped but RBS customers said they were worried by the falling share price, although they acknowledged it was part of a bigger picture of worldwide financial instability.
